Gimp homepage http://www.gimp.org/ Gimp for windows download http://www.gimp.org/windows/ Gimp screenshots http://www.gimp.org/screenshots/ This weekend I installed and configured a Linux laptop and was reminded of and installed Gimp - a freeware program that duplicates the functionality of Photoshop (e.g. layers and masking). Although I had always understood Gimp to be a unix program, I found that it has also been ported to Windows XP and Vista. So, if you do not have Photoshop because of the bucks involved, Gimp is a good free open source alternative to look at. Clear Skies - Kurt
